What is primary care?

Primary care is a specialty of medicine that promotes your general health and helps you take steps to prevent illnesses and injuries. At L.A. Urgent Care & Occupational Medicine, you can access fast primary care services like diagnostic testing and general treatments for nonemergency conditions.

Primary care providers have a wide scope of expertise. They can treat conditions and symptoms originating in many different organs and systems and can help you learn to stay healthy in the future. They can also refer you to trusted specialists for more advanced or specific health care.

If you arrive at the clinic with symptoms, the team asks about your medical history, the onset and characteristics of the symptoms, and any medications you currently take. They perform a physical exam and any necessary further testing. Then, they devise a treatment plan with medications, therapies, and other treatments to improve your condition or help you manage it.

If you’re bleeding a lot or lose consciousness, emergency care may be a better option for you than primary care. However, primary care can address many conditions and complications without the wait times and rushed care of an emergency visit.
